The outstanding item is the capital budget request from the Trellis Systems division: new tooling for the Corvid assembly line, phased over two years. I've reviewed the figures with Finance twice; the numbers hold, but the second tranche assumes volumes we haven't yet committed to. The board deferred a decision last session pending market data, which is now in. Arledge should present at the next meeting with a firm recommendation. The confidential planning assumption driving the request is noted below.

management briefing: Project Ulavan slips by two quarters because of the staffing delay.

## Provenance — Payload Compression (Skyvane)

Telemetry payloads are zstd-compressed at level 6 in the Skyvane collector. Dictionary trained on the Q3 corpus; retrain quarterly. Reviewer: verify the dictionary hash in the manifest matches the artifact store entry, and that no debug path bypasses compression. All of this is pinned to the release token that appears below.

pipeline stamp: htk31_f769b577b3028a4e9958e5bb8d1259a

## Tuning: Dependency Pinning (Skiffjar)

On-call: Skiffjar pins all direct dependencies to exact versions; transitive deps resolve through the lockfile only. Automated bumps run nightly and open PRs that auto-merge if CI is green and the bump is a patch release. Minor and major bumps require human review. If a security advisory lands, the pinner force-bumps within the SLA window regardless of schedule. You can pause the bot during incidents via the freeze flag. The scheduler's timing constants are below.

tuning table, fawip-fahag:
WEIGHTS = {
    "novwyn": 452,
    "casdor": 675,
}